POLISH KAPUSTA KIELBASA



Polish Kapusta Kielbasa image

So easy! Kapusta is a Polish kielbasa sausage dish that is even better the second day. Paired with crusty bread, dinner is served!

Provided by SmHerndon

Categories     One Dish Meal

Time 1h35m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 (16 ounce) jar sauerkraut
1 medium onion, peeled & chopped
butter
2 (14 1/2 ounce) cans butter beans
1 (2 link) package kielbasa, cut in chunks
salt & pepper, to taste

Steps:

  • In a stockpot, add sauerkraut and bring to boil; rinse and drain.
  • Return sauerkraut to stockpot and add enough water to cover sauerkraut.
  • In a small skillet, saute onion in butter until soft. Add butter beans and cook at least 30 minutes.
  • Add kielbasa and cook 45 minutes to 1 hour, the longer the better.
  • Season with salt and pepper and serve with crusty bread.

KIELBASA IN POLISH SAUCE



Kielbasa in Polish Sauce image

Provided by Food Network

Categories     main-dish

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 tablespoons finely chopped parsley
12 ounces light beer
1 1/2 cups water
2 cups chopped yellow onions
2 pounds Kielbasa sausage, links
Salt
Freshly ground black pepper
2 tablespoons butter
2 tablespoons flour
2 tablespoons white vinegar
1 tablespoon sugar

Steps:

  • In a saucepan, over medium heat, combine the beer, water, onions and sausage. Season with salt and pepper. Bring to a boil, reduce to a simmer and cook, covered, for 25 minutes. Remove the sausage from the pan and cool. Slice the sausage into 1 -inch pieces. In a large saute pan, over medium heat, melt the butter. Stir in the flour and cook for 4 to 6 minutes for a light brown roux. Stir in the vinegar, sugar and the reserved beer and onion mixture. Season with salt and pepper. Bring the mixture to a boil, reduce to a simmer and continue to cook until the sauce coats the back of a spoon, about 15 minutes. Add the sliced sausage and continue to cook for 5 minutes. Garnish with parsley.

POLISH GOULASH WITH KIELBASA



Polish Goulash With Kielbasa image

This recipe was adapted from one published in the Los Angeles Times about 20 years ago, when they did a feature on polish food. The original recipe called for lard, I make it with canola oil

Provided by lynnski LA

Categories     One Dish Meal

Time 50m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 1/2 lbs potatoes
3 ounces canola oil
1 large onion, chopped
2 garlic cloves, minced
salt, to taste
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
1/2 teaspoon paprika
1/4 teaspoon caraway seed
1/4 teaspoon crushed marjoram leaves
6 ounces kielbasa, thinly sliced
2 cups stock or 2 cups water
2 tablespoons flour
2 teaspoons tomato paste

Steps:

  • Peel and cube potatoes.
  • Pour oil into a deep skillet, add onion and saute until translucent.
  • Add garlic, salt (to taste), pepper, paprika, caraway, marjoram and sausage.
  • Cook about 4 minutes, then stir in potatoes.
  • Pour in enough stock to cover.
  • Simmer until potatoes are tender.
  • Pour about 2 tablespoons oil into a small saucepan, ans stir in 2 tablespoons flour.
  • Cook stirring until flour turns golden.
  • Remove from heat and add 1/2 cup water from potato mixture, mix in the water and simmer to make a roux, add roux to the goulash.
  • Bring goulash to boiling point and remove from heat.
  • Serve over cooked noodles, and with a veggie side dish.

POLISH SKILLET WITH KIELBASA



Polish Skillet With Kielbasa image

Good Polish-Slovak food, very Pittsburgh-ese. I modified it from a base recipe I found on AllRecipes and added a few touches of my own.

Provided by HisPixie

Categories     One Dish Meal

Time 50m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

4 potatoes, peeled and cut into 1 inch cubes
1 onion, chopped
1 green bell pepper, cut into thin slices
1 red bell pepper, cut into thin slices
1/2 teaspoon onion powder
1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
2 tablespoons vegetable oil
15 ounces sauerkraut, drained
16 ounces kielbasa, cut into 1 inch pieces

Steps:

  • Heat o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Cook potatoes for 10 minutes.
  • Add peppers, onions and seasonings, cover and cook for 5 more minutes.
  • Stir in kielbasa and sauerkraut, cover, and cook for 15 minutes, or until onions are caramelized.

WHAT IS KIELBASA? - THE SPRUCE EATS
The word kielbasa (keel-BAH-sah) is Polish for " sausage ." It stretches far beyond the large smoked links commonly seen vacuum-packed in grocery stores. Polish sausage may be smoked, fresh, or cured, and include pork, veal, or any variety of meats; some types are from pork shoulder, and others use scraps or ground meat.

POLISH FOOD 101 ‒ KIEłBASA | ARTICLE | CULTURE.PL
White sausage (biała kiełbasa). A delicious sausage sold uncooked and unsmoked. It may be either boiled, fried, grilled (served with horseradish) or cooked in a sour rye soup (żurek). Some recipes – depending on the region - use spices such as garlic, marjoram, black and white pepper and salt.
